How to Login to Your iolo System Mechanic Account on PC: A Complete Guide

Learn how to login to your iolo System Mechanic account on PC with step-by-step instructions, software sign-in methods, and solutions to common login issues.

iolo System Mechanic is a comprehensive PC optimization and maintenance tool designed to improve system speed, enhance security, and maintain overall computer performance. To unlock all premium features, activate your license, and manage your subscription, logging in to your iolo System Mechanic account on your PC is an essential step.

Whether you are setting up System Mechanic for the first time, reinstalling it on a new computer, or accessing your account details, understanding the login process ensures a smooth experience. This guide explains how to login iolo System Mechanic account on a PC, including both browser-based and software-based login methods, along with helpful troubleshooting tips.


Understanding iolo System Mechanic Account Login on PC

On a PC, users can log in to their iolo System Mechanic account in two main ways: through a web browser or directly through the System Mechanic software installed on the computer. Both options provide access to your account and ensure that your license is properly linked to your device.

By logging in on a PC, you can:

  • Activate or verify your System Mechanic license

  • Access advanced optimization and security features

  • Manage your subscription and renewal settings

  • Download the latest software version

  • Review account and billing information

Understanding these login options helps you choose the most convenient method.


What You Need Before Logging In on PC

Before beginning the login process, make sure you have the following ready:

  1. Registered Email Address
    Use the email address associated with your System Mechanic purchase or account registration.

  2. Account Password
    Enter your password carefully, keeping in mind that it is case-sensitive.

  3. Stable Internet Connection
    An active internet connection is required for account verification and license validation.

  4. Updated PC Environment
    Ensure your operating system, browser, and System Mechanic software are up to date.


Method 1: Login Through a Web Browser on PC

Step 1: Start Your PC and Open a Browser

Turn on your PC and open a web browser of your choice.

Step 2: Visit the Official iolo Website

In the browser’s address bar, type the official iolo website address and allow the page to load completely.

Step 3: Find the Account Login Option

Look for an option labeled “Sign In,” “Login,” or “My Account,” usually located in the top navigation area.

Step 4: Enter Your Email Address

Type the email address linked to your iolo System Mechanic account into the email field.

Step 5: Enter Your Password

Carefully enter your password, ensuring correct spelling and capitalization.

Step 6: Click the Login Button

Click the login or sign-in button to access your account dashboard.


Method 2: Login Through the System Mechanic Software on PC

Step 1: Launch the System Mechanic Application

Open the System Mechanic program installed on your PC.

Step 2: Locate the Sign-In or Account Section

On the main interface, look for an option such as “Sign In,” “Activate,” or “Account.”

Step 3: Enter Your Account Credentials

Enter your registered email address and password in the appropriate fields.

Step 4: Complete the Login Process

Once verified, your account will be linked to the software and your license will be activated if it is not already active.


Logging In After Installing System Mechanic on PC

If you have recently installed System Mechanic, the software may automatically prompt you to log in.

During this process:

  • Use the same email address used during purchase

  • Enter your account password when prompted

  • Allow the software to verify your license online

This ensures that all premium features are unlocked.


Navigating Your iolo Account Dashboard on PC

After logging in, you will be directed to your account dashboard. The PC interface provides a clear and user-friendly layout for managing your subscription.

From the dashboard, you can:

  • View active licenses and connected devices

  • Check subscription status and renewal dates

  • Download System Mechanic installers

  • Update account details such as email or password

  • Review order and billing history

These tools give you full control over your iolo System Mechanic account.


What to Do If You Forgot Your Password on PC

If you cannot remember your password, resetting it is simple.

Step 1: Click “Forgot Password”

On the login page, click the option indicating you forgot your password.

Step 2: Enter Your Registered Email Address

Provide the email address linked to your iolo account.

Step 3: Follow the Password Reset Instructions

You will receive an email with steps to create a new password.

Step 4: Log In Using the New Password

Return to the login page and sign in using your updated credentials.


Common Login Issues on PC and How to Fix Them

Incorrect Login Details

Make sure that:

  • The correct email address is used

  • The password is entered correctly

  • Caps Lock is not enabled

Software Not Accepting Credentials

If System Mechanic does not accept your login:

  • Ensure the software is updated

  • Confirm you are using the correct account email

Browser-Related Problems

If logging in via browser fails:

  • Clear browser cache and cookies

  • Try a different browser

Internet Connectivity Issues

An unstable internet connection may interrupt login verification. Ensure your connection is stable before trying again.


Security Tips for PC Users

Keeping your account secure is essential, especially on shared or public computers.

  • Use a strong, unique password

  • Avoid saving login details on shared PCs

  • Log out after accessing your account

  • Keep your operating system and software updated

These practices help protect your subscription and personal information.


Logging Out of Your iolo System Mechanic Account on PC

Once you are done managing your account, logging out is recommended.

To log out:

  1. Navigate to your account dashboard or software interface

  2. Find the logout or sign-out option

  3. Select it to securely end your session

Logging out helps prevent unauthorized access.


Benefits of Logging In on PC

Logging in on a PC provides several advantages:

  • Direct integration with the System Mechanic software

  • Faster license activation and feature access

  • Full account and subscription management

  • Easier downloads and updates

These benefits make the PC the primary and most efficient platform for using iolo System Mechanic.


Final Thoughts

Logging in to your iolo System Mechanic account on a PC is a straightforward process that gives you full control over your software, license, and subscription. Whether you choose to log in through a web browser or directly within the System Mechanic application, following the correct steps ensures a smooth and secure experience.

By preparing your credentials in advance, understanding the available login methods, and applying basic security practices, you can confidently access your iolo System Mechanic account and keep your PC running at its best.